Varicocele

Varicocele: Causes, Symptoms, Diagnosis, and Treatment Options

Varicocele is one of the most common causes of male infertility and is defined as the abnormal enlargement and twisting of the veins in the testicles (pampiniform plexus). It is similar to varicose veins in the legs and usually occurs in the left testicle, although it can affect both sides. Varicocele can impact sperm quality and male hormone production, potentially leading to infertility.

Causes of Varicocele

Varicocele occurs due to malfunction of the valves in the testicular veins. Normally, these valves prevent blood from flowing backward, but when they fail, blood pools in the veins, causing them to dilate and twist. Factors contributing to varicocele include:

  1. Anatomical factors: Differences in the anatomy of the left and right testicular veins make varicocele more common on the left side. The left testicular vein is longer and drains at a sharper angle into the renal vein, which increases pressure.
  2. Abdominal pressure: Increased abdominal pressure from obesity, chronic constipation, or heavy lifting may raise the risk of varicocele.
  3. Genetic factors: Some studies suggest that genetic predisposition may play a role in the development of varicocele.

Symptoms of Varicocele

Varicocele may be asymptomatic and discovered incidentally during medical examinations. However, possible symptoms include:

  1. Pain or discomfort: This can range from a mild feeling of heaviness to severe pain, usually worsening with prolonged standing or physical activity and improving when lying down.
  2. Testicular swelling: Varicocele may cause enlargement or swelling of the testicle.
  3. Infertility: Varicocele is a leading cause of male infertility and can negatively affect sperm count and quality.
  4. Testicular atrophy: In advanced cases, varicocele may cause testicular shrinkage (atrophy).

Diagnosis of Varicocele

Diagnosis typically begins with a physical examination. The physician may feel dilated or swollen veins in the scrotum. To confirm diagnosis and assess severity, imaging tests may be used:

  1. Ultrasound: Testicular ultrasound can measure dilated veins and assess blood flow.
  2. Doppler ultrasound: Helps evaluate venous blood flow and detect valve insufficiency.
  3. Venography: In rare cases, venography (contrast dye injection into the veins) may be performed for detailed evaluation.

Treatment Options for Varicocele

Treatment depends on symptom severity, patient age, and fertility goals. If varicocele is asymptomatic and does not affect fertility, treatment may not be necessary. However, treatment is required in cases of pain, infertility, or testicular atrophy.

1. Varicocelectomy Surgery

Varicocelectomy is the most common treatment for varicocele. In this procedure, the dilated veins are tied off or removed to restore normal blood flow. Surgical techniques include:

  • Open surgery: A small incision is made in the groin or abdomen to ligate or remove the dilated veins.
  • Laparoscopy: Using small instruments and a camera, the dilated veins are sealed through small abdominal incisions.
  • Microsurgery: A microscope is used to precisely ligate the veins while avoiding damage to surrounding structures.

2. Varicocele Embolization

Embolization is a minimally invasive procedure where a catheter is used to inject embolic material into the dilated veins, blocking them. This is usually done under local anesthesia and does not require general anesthesia.


Advantages and Disadvantages of Treatment Methods

  • Varicocelectomy (surgery): Effective with long-term results, but carries risks such as infection, bleeding, or injury to nearby structures.
  • Embolization: Minimally invasive with shorter recovery time, but in some cases, retreatment may be required.

Frequently Asked Questions about Varicocele

Does varicocele always cause infertility?
No, varicocele does not always result in infertility, but it can reduce sperm quality and increase the risk.

Which treatment method is better for varicocele?
Treatment choice depends on disease severity, patient age, and fertility goals. Microsurgical varicocelectomy is among the most effective techniques.

Can varicocele be treated without surgery?
Yes, in mild or asymptomatic cases, no surgery is needed. Embolization is also a non-surgical option.

What is the recovery time after varicocele treatment?
Recovery is typically 2–5 days after minimally invasive procedures like embolization and 7–10 days after open surgery.

Can varicocele recur?
Yes, recurrence can occur, especially after incomplete treatment, and may require retreatment.
